# Settings for Trailmark offline mode.
# Offline queue flushes when connectivity returns; do not clear it manually.
# If sync stalls past 30 min, restart the sync daemon, not the app.
# Conflicts resolve last-write-wins; escalate anything else.
# The sync daemon writes checkpoints to the staging database given below.

warehouse DSN: clickhouse://druys_svc:Pl@db-47e1.orvexstack.corp:5432/beldor

This section covers the circuit breaker we place in front of the Verdantis pricing API. When consecutive failures exceed the threshold, the breaker opens and requests fail fast, protecting our worker pool from thread starvation. After the cooldown, a half-open probe decides whether to close again. Please do not adjust these values without a load test in the Brackenfield staging environment. The production constants currently deployed are shown below.

tuning constants:
RATE_LIMITS = {
    "wenwyn": 1,
    "zorix": 10,
    "oliix": 2,
    "holael": 10,
}

Quick note for review: the Pinwheel address autocomplete widget talks to our internal Mapletide geocoding service, not the public one. All requests go through the `PinwheelClient` wrapper, which handles rate limiting and caching so you don't have to think about it. The widget refuses to initialize without a valid key, and it fails loudly on purpose — silent fallbacks caused the Harrowgate incident last quarter. Staging and prod keys are separate; don't mix them. For local testing, the client reads the key from config, shown below.

gateway credential: kto23_LX9A4ys6i4nzHtpOLNLodKK

**Mgmt Meeting Minutes — Retiring the Brightline Range**

Quick recap for sales leads at Fenholt Supplies: we agreed to retire the Brightline fixture range by year-end. Remaining stock moves to clearance pricing next month, and accounts on standing orders get migrated to the Lumetta range. Trade-in incentives were approved in principle. The confidential note on next steps sits just below.

board note of bajof-bajeg: The pricing group signed off on a budget of $13.4 million for Project Sildor. The renewal with Lamixek Holdings closes at $48.9 million a year, 49 percent above the last contract.